Every journey we take on engenders a bonus to our personality, regardless of traveling solo or in a group, a hodophile or not, a kid or a grown-up. Heading out to places that were never visited earlier offers profound challenges. Oftentimes, it’s a finer choice than au fait destinations.

Reaching the spot isn’t the sole impetus. In fact, the initial planning phase of hand-picking the right location, budget calculation, confirming the place of stay, researching the activities in the destination can all be uplifting.

Let’s ponder on how individuals reap the benefits of setting out to travel.

Motley Environs — Offers Scope for Learning

‘Travel is still the most intense mode of learning’. If you’ve traveled to Ladhak, this quote is visible on a signboard en route to Nubra Valley. Be it venturing into a sport or activity, exploring the history of places, experimenting with cuisines, familiarizing with the lifestyle of the local people. Each of these refines the individual with knowledge galore and enlightens the minds.

Bonding — Creates cherishable Memories

Journeying with family, friends, colleagues are ideal occasions for cementing relationships. In our otherwise preoccupied lives, bonding with people takes a backseat. Trips strengthen and revive relationships giving a new dimension altogether. If traveling solo, there is always room for cultivating friendships with strangers. And you could become cronies with some of them.

Self Discovery — Opportunity to Know Yourself Better

Incessantly, we search for happiness, satisfaction, peace in external factors. Wouldn’t it be good to pause and look within ourselves and get to know our authentic selves? Tours can be meditative too especially in the midst of nature. A long walk in the lush greenery, gazing at the sunset, engaging in writing thoughts, leads to contemplative experiences. Gradually, we encounter the uniqueness of who we are.

Growth — Liberation from the comfort zone

Breaking the routine opens channels for exploring unknown zones. Often we find ourselves comfortable with the mundane activities of life. It does take a level of moxie to step into an unexplored land and confront the challenges. Every expedition comes with its set of onerous circumstances. And when we face and rise above such situations, we flounder and it often leads to growth.

Rejuvenation — Generates a New Purpose to Life

Long holidays and minibreaks enable us to breathe new life into our monotonous lives. We become revitalized as a consequence of thriving in an offbeat and sedate environment. It also facilitates bringing in novelty in specific areas of our lives. Chances are that, that we will look forward to returning to our daily schedule, coupled with ardor and zeal.

Hence embark on a journey and dare to try out adventurous activities such as trekking, rafting, bungee jumping, scuba diving, paragliding, and sense the thrills of accomplishment. Or set off to a serene location and visualize the deep beauty of life unfold in the landscapes.
